As data warehouses continue to evolve, the importance of a robust semantic layer in data warehouse architecture cannot be overstated. This critical component serves as an intermediary between raw data and end-users, providing a simplified, business-focused view of complex datasets. In this blog post, we will delve into the various aspects that make semantic layers indispensable for modern data engineering teams.
We will discuss how incorporating a semantic layer in data warehouse can accelerate time-to-insight for users while improving query performance and reducing analytics processing costs. We'll also explore Kyvos' Universal Semantic Layer solution and its ability to handle large-scale datasets efficiently by offering industry-specific solutions.
Furthermore, we'll examine the integration of cloud-based warehouses with self-serve analytics tools and their advantages over traditional on-premise data warehouses. As we progress through our discussion on implementing semantic models in data warehouses, you'll learn about standardizing enterprise-wide metrics definitions and striking the right balance between accessibility and security concerns.
Last but not least, we will touch upon how modern BI platforms are addressing traditional shortcomings by enhancing capabilities through new technology integrations and innovating beyond conventional approaches. One such example is Looker's declarative approach to semantic layer methodology which offers several benefits while exploring innovative options like data virtualization.
The Importance of Semantic Layer in Data Warehouses
Semantic layer maps complex data stores and enables users to interact with data definitions warehouses using business-friendly terms, thereby simplifying complex datasets and optimizing query performance.
Accelerating time-to-insight for users: Simplifying data definitions models structures leads to faster insights, allowing users to spend more time on analysis rather than navigating through raw datasets.
Improving query performance: The semantic layer optimizes queries by translating user requests into efficient SQL statements, resulting in improved response times and overall system performance.
Reducing analytics processing costs: An effective semantic layers implementation can reduce resource consumption by eliminating redundant calculations or aggregations performed across multiple tools or platforms, saving businesses time and money.
Check out this insightful article on business intelligence solutions for ecommerce and enterprise companies to learn more about how companies like Zenlytic use modern approaches to build powerful semantic layer maps complex data models for their clients' needs.
Kyvos' Universal Semantic Layer Solution
The Kyvos universal semantic layer platform efficiently handles large-scale datasets by utilizing relationships between schema elements, providing industry-specific insights for better decision-making processes.
Optimal performance: Kyvos allows data engineers to work with massive amounts of data lakes, ensuring optimal performance even in the most demanding scenarios.
Industry-specific solutions: Retail companies can collect omnichannel customer experience improvement insights, while healthcare organizations can leverage it for rapid resource reassignment towards improved health outcomes.
This innovative approach empowers users across various industries to access critical information quickly and easily, unlocking the full potential of their data scientists warehouse investments.
Integrating Cloud-Based Warehouses with Self-Serve Analytics Tools
Cloud data warehouses-based warehouses, such as Snowflake, have gained prominence in recent times due to their scalability, flexibility and cost efficiency for larger organizations.
Self-service analytics tools like Datameer have emerged to empower users with rich meta source data sources generation capabilities and detailed properties documentation features.
Advantages of integrating cloud-based warehouses: Improved query performance and reduced costs compared to traditional on-premises infrastructure.
Role of self-service analytics tools: Enables end-users to access and analyze source data sources using familiar business terms without relying on IT support or extensive technical knowledge.
Choosing compatible warehouse technologies and user-friendly analytics tools that promote collaboration across teams is essential for a successful semantic layer platform implementation in a cloud environment.
Implementing Semantic Models in Data Warehouses
Semantic models standardize enterprise analytics, turning all users into big data-driven decision-makers by mapping business data models into familiar terms, aggregating siloed information, and contextualizing it for accurate decision-making.
Standardizing Metrics Definitions
Semantic models help standardize metrics definitions across various departments, creating a consistent view of the organization's source data platform and ensuring everyone is working with the same understanding of key performance indicators (KPIs).
Tools like Tableau can be used to build these standardized metric definitions within your warehouse.
Accessibility vs. Security
A well-implemented semantic model balances accessibility for end-users while maintaining security protocols around sensitive information.
By controlling access permissions at different levels of granularity, organizations can ensure that only authorized personnel have access to specific data products sets or KPIs within their warehouse environment using platforms such as Power BI.
Modern BI Platforms Addressing Traditional Shortcomings
Today's business intelligence (BI) platforms, like AtScale, are evolving to address the known shortcomings of traditional systems while innovating on what originally made the semantic layer enables retailers platform great.
By incorporating powerful layers such as APIs, caching, access control, data platform products modeling, and metrics layers into their solutions, these modern platforms offer a more robust approach to managing enterprise data products.
Boosting capabilities with new tech integrations: Integrating cutting-edge technologies enables BI platforms to provide advanced analytics features that were previously unattainable in traditional systems.
Innovating beyond traditional semantic layer platform approaches: Modern BI platforms explore novel ways of handling complex data platform structures and relationships, allowing for greater flexibility and scalability when dealing with large-scale datasets.
Organizations must adopt modern BI solutions that can effectively manage their ever-growing volumes of unify data engineers while addressing the limitations of legacy systems to stay competitive in today's fast-paced business environment.
Looker's Declarative Approach to Semantic Layer Methodology
Looker's declarative approach to semantic layer enables retailers methodology simplifies the process of creating and maintaining a unified view of data across an organization.
Using LookML, users can easily describe relationships between tables in a human-readable format, leading to faster development cycles for new reports or dashboards.
This approach ensures that all users are working with consistent definitions, increasing efficiency and consistency.
Advantages of a declarative approach: Reusing metrics throughout analytics workflows saves time and ensures consistency.
Exploring data virtualization options: The Semantic Layer Summit, organized by Supergrain, discusses advancements in this field, including data virtualization as a viable option for centralizing metric definitions.
Benefits of data virtualization: Data virtualization allows for real-time access to data from multiple sources without the need for data replication, reducing costs and improving agility.
By adopting Looker's declarative approach or exploring data virtualization options, organizations can streamline their relevant data management processes and improve their analytics capabilities.
FAQs in Relation to Semantic Layer in Data Warehouse
As a modern blog editor experienced in SEO, I always write in an active voice.
Short, witty, and funny sentences are my preference.
SEO keywords like semantic layer, data warehouse, and big data stores can be seamlessly integrated into my writing.
By using a semantic layer platform, retailers can easily unify data products from various sources and create a consolidated view.
Cloud data warehouses are becoming increasingly popular, but on-premise data warehouses still have their place.
Data scientists, engineers, and analysts rely on semantic layer maps to understand complex data.
Adding hierarchies to a semantic model can improve query performance and provide a more relevant data stores representation.
Whether it's data marts, data products, or data stores, a universal semantic layer can help businesses access the data they need.
Star schema is a popular data model for creating a consolidated view of corporate data.
Data lakes are a newer approach to storing big data, but they still require careful management.
By unifying data from various sources, businesses can gain a better understanding of their customers and make more informed decisions.
Strong and bold tags can be used to emphasize important points.
Links to credible sources can be added to backup claims and provide additional information.
A semantic layer in data warehouse is crucial for faster insights, improved query performance, and reduced analytics costs in data warehousing. Kyvos' Universal Semantic Layer Solution efficiently handles large-scale datasets and provides industry-specific solutions, while cloud-based warehouses integration offers several advantages, including self-service analytics tools.
Modern BI platforms enhance capabilities with new technology integrations and innovative semantic layer approaches, such as Looker's declarative methodology that offers data virtualization options.
Want to see how Zenlytic can make sense of all of your data?